My cooler is RMA so need something just for a week or two. I just need something cheap and the Intel cooler is very cheap. Just wanted to know if the Intel cooler will fit a skylake chip?
 
It should fit no problem. Also an older one should work fine - the one that came with my 2600K for example is a small low profile type thing and that CPU is rated for 95w TDP. The 6700K is rated for 91w TDP, so you should be fine with it.
